import os
from pathlib import Path
import logging
import shutil
import numpy as np
class FileBasedDatabase:
def __init__(self, path: str):
if not os.path.exists(path):
logging.info("Directory %s will be created as it does not exist.", path)
os.makedirs(path)
self._path = path
self._boards_filename = "boards.npy"
self._events_filename = "events.npy"
def get_index_or_default(name):
try:
return int(name)
except ValueError:
return -1
with os.scandir(path) as it:
self._count = (
max(
(
get_index_or_default(Path(folder.path).name)
for folder in it
if folder.is_dir()
),
default=-1,
)
+ 1
)
@property
def path(self):
return self._path
def __len__(self):
return self._count
def __getitem__(self, idx):
folder = Path(self._path) / str(idx)
if not os.path.exists(folder):
raise IndexError()
boards = np.load(folder / self._boards_filename)
actions = np.load(folder / self._events_filename)
return boards, actions
def insert(self, boards, events):
folder = Path(self._path) / str(self._count)
folder.mkdir()
np.save(folder / self._boards_filename, boards)
np.save(folder / self._events_filename, events)
self._count += 1
# Doesn't preserve ordering
def delete(self, idx):
self.delete_batch([idx])
# Doesn't preserve ordering
def delete_batch(self, idxs):
# Delete folders
for idx in idxs:
folder = Path(self._path) / str(idx)
logging.debug("Deleting '%s'", folder)
shutil.rmtree(folder)
# Reindex remaining folders
old_idx = self._count
new_idx = min(idxs) - 1
while True:
old_exists = False
while not old_exists:
old_idx -= 1
old_folder = Path(self._path) / str(old_idx)
old_exists = old_folder.exists()
new_exists = True
while new_exists:
new_idx += 1
new_folder = Path(self._path) / str(new_idx)
new_exists = new_folder.exists()
if old_idx <= new_idx:
break
logging.debug("Renaming '%s' to '%s'", old_folder, new_folder)
old_folder.rename(new_folder)
# Adjust count
self._count -= len(idxs)
def delete_all(self):
# Delete folders
# We can't just call shutil.rmtree on the whole folder as there might be other subfolders (e.g. nested databases,
# as in the data preparation notebook).
for idx in range(self._count):
folder = Path(self._path) / str(idx)
logging.debug("Deleting '%s'", folder)
shutil.rmtree(folder)
# Adjust count
self._count = 0
